I cracked open my air filter over the weekend to change the filter and clean things up a bit. I noticed that the air pipe right after the AFM was wet. It was a very dirty black colour with some chunks in it. Didn;t smell like anything (I should have tried to light it to see if was gas). Any ideas. Van runs great, fuel economy is a bit down from last summer. This is an '84 automatic tranny.

On another tangent, My O2 light hasn't come on yet, I've put about 70,000 km on it since I bought it. When does the light come on?
